文档介绍:基于移动终端的油气开发数据采集模式探索
张苏 张桂凤 黎萌 张华义 陈果 [摘 要] 为了实现油气开发生产环节中产生的数据得到及时、准确、全面的采集,避免在基层存在多个相互独立的系统均有数据采集模块,导致员工重复录入和错误rvice服务接口。
数据服务层:集成到企业服务总线上的基础公共数据服务,以及按照SOA服务标准规范开发的系统基础业务数据服务;基于SOA松耦合特性,需要对各种服务进行注册,以方便服务提供者发布自己的服务、服务消费查找所需的服务。服务注册中心需要提供分类管理能力,实现对服务的搜索。
移动应用技术:基础技术(应用程序基础框架)是Android应用开发的基础,该层提供了很多的核心功能组件,应用程序可以直接使用其提供的组件快速应用到程序中,也可以通过继承实现个性化的拓展。如Activity Manager管理各个应用程序的生命周期以及通常的导航回退功能。Content Provider通过内容提供器可以在不同的应用程序之间存取或者分享数据。View System构建应用程序界面的基本组件。核心模块:提供了数据服务层和移动应用组件层之间的数据交互接口统一封装,组件消息事件管理。 移动终端部署框架设计
部署架构采用“云+网+端”部署模式,部署统一的应用服务器和数据服务器,现场操作人员采用移动终端、站场人员利用PC桌面,借助于网络来使用云端的各类应用。
应用服务器与数据库服务器:利用虚拟服务器软件,将应用服务器和数据服务器统一部署,实现系统云网端部署。
办公计算机:系统各类管理用户通过有线网络,使用各类应用。
移动终端:在工作现场无公用网络支持的情况下,一线井站用户在作业区或中心站将工作有关的信息下载到移动终端上;操作时通过按照下载的操作步骤等信息,实现对现场工作的支持,记录工作结果并进行暂存;在工作完成后,在作业区或中心站将与工作有关的操作结果上传到系统中,如图3所示。
优化管理流程,构建全新的数据采集模式
根据作业区日常工作特点,将基础工作相关的管理流程归纳为巡回检查、常规操作、分析处理、维护保养、检查维修(施工作业)、变更管理、属地监督、作业许可管理、危害因素辨识、物资管理等10大类通用管理流程。
本文以巡回检查为例,分析如何实现数据采集。图4为巡回检查流程图,此流程可完成场站和管线定期进行巡回检查。如:单井站(井口区、药剂加注区、水套炉加热区、分离计量区等)、脱水站(三甘醇脱水装置区、分子筛脱水装置区)、电力线及电力设施巡检等。此流程在巡检记录填报功能点处可以完***工采集数据项采集,如单井员工日常巡检,可完成药剂加注记录填报等数据;脱水站员工日常巡检,可完成三甘醇脱水装置运行日报表和分子筛脱水装置运行日报表等数据。
4 現场移动终端应用场景设计
如图6所示,一线井站操作用户根据任务来源,进行作业前准备,并由作业监督人在移动终端上进行确认。在现场操作的过程中,作业监督人员对现场操作进行作业安全风险提示和操作步骤确认。在作业过程中,系统向移动终端推送工作对象有关的运行、维护、保养及隐患信息提示,在操作完成后,作业监督根据系统推送的录入界面进行与工作有关的数据录入工作。
5 结论